Hopewell Spring Cleanup

April 16, 2022 | Published by Julie Buchanan

Keep Hopewell Beautiful and the Hopewell Public Works Department have scheduled a citywide cleanup from Saturday, April 16 through Saturday, April 23. Residents are encouraged to clean up around their homes and streets. During the week, Hopewell residents may dispose of items at no charge at the Citizen Convenience Center, 507 Station St., behind Fire Station #1.
